0

0xlab の Android ポートを使い始めたところです。ファイルシステムを正常に作成でき、フラッシュもできました。ただし、2 つの質問があります。1) ramdisk イメージを作成するにはどうすればよいですか。また、このために uboot プロンプトで指定される bootargs は何ですか。(out/target/beagleboard/ で作成された ramdisk.img を使用しようとしましたが、使用するとカーネルが起動しません。誰か助けてくれませんか? 2) モジュールをファイル システムの一部にするにはどうすればよいですか?画像。カーネルの起動後にインストールしたい独自のドライバーがあります。このモジュールが android.ubi イメージの一部であることを確認する手順は何ですか?

誰かがこれで私を助けてください。モジュールを起動して実行する必要がありますが、モジュールを ramdisk image/android.ubi の一部にする方法がわからないため、先に進むことができません。誰かがここで私を助けてくれることを願っています。

どうもありがとう!

4

1 に答える 1

1

生成された「ramdisk.img」は、起動には必要ありません。代わりに、Linux カーネル イメージと android イメージ (system.img) を気にする必要があります。wikiページをよく確認してください。

また、ビルド済みの独自のカーネル モジュールをファイル「Android.mk」に記述することもできます。例: http://gitorious.org/0xdroid/packages_apps_demo-apks/blobs/beagle-donut/Android.mk

于 2010-11-27T17:59:18.400 に答える